2024
June
Started selling Customer Communication Hub “NEOPORT”
April
Established subsidiary NEOPhilippine Tech Inc. in Republic of the Philippines
2022
April
NEOJAPAN Inc. has moved to the PRIME section of the Tokyo Stock Exchange.
February
Fukuoka sales office established to serve as a new communications base for the Kyushu region of central Japan
2021
February
Established subsidiary NEO THAI ASIA co.,Ltd. in the Kingdom of Thailand.
2019
December
Established subsidiary NEOREKA ASIA Sdn.Bhd. in Malaysia
August
Acquired Pro-SPIRE (made a subsidiary)
June
Established subsidiary DELCUI Inc. in the United States of America
May
Nagoya sales office established to serve as a new communications base for the Tokai region of central Japan
2018
January
NEOJAPAN share listing shifted to the First Section of the Tokyo Stock Exchange

2017
October
desknet’s NEO V4.0 released with the new “AppSuite”
January
Osaka sales office established to serve as a new communications base for the Kansai region
2015
December
ChatLuck on-premise business chat system released
November
NEOJAPAN shares listed on the Tokyo Stock Exchange

2013
February
desknet’s NEO package services for small and medium-sized companies and desknet’s cloud service launched
2012
December
desknet’s NEO package services for small and medium-sized companies launched
2009
January
Addition of a new ECO-themed application to the SaaS service Applitus. Provision of a total of 20 types of applications and services
2006
September
NEOJAPAN becomes the first Japanese company to offer customizable ASP services (SaaS)
2004
August
NEOJAPAN headquarters and Tokyo office moved to Yokohama Landmark Tower to increase business potential
2002
April
desknet’s groupware package developed and released (successor to iOffice)
2001
April
desknet’s Enterprise Edition groupware for large companies released
2000
April
iOffice SSS sales support system package developed and released
1999
January
iOffice 2000 web groupware package developed and released
1992
March
Large-scale UNIX network OA system constructed for TEPCO (Tokyo Electric Power Company)
February
Established of NEOJAPAN
